当前位置:首页 > 行业动态 > 正文

如何利用CDN优化Vue.js应用的性能?

CDN (Content Delivery Network) 是一种用于加速网页加载的技术,通过在全球多个数据中心缓存网站内容,使用户可以从最近的服务器快速获取数据。Vue.js 是一个流行的前端 JavaScript 框架,用于构建用户界面和单页面应用。结合 CDN 使用 Vue.js 可以提高应用的性能和响应速度。

CDN使用详解

如何利用CDN优化Vue.js应用的性能?  第1张

CDN,全称为内容分发网络(Content Delivery Network),是一组分布在全球的服务器,用于缓存和传输站点的静态资源,Vue.js 支持通过 CDN 引入其库文件,这可以极大地加快应用的加载速度并降低服务器的负载,使用 CDN 也存在一定风险,如网络问题可能导致 CDN 服务中断,本部分将详细解析如何正确使用 CDN 引入 Vue.js,并提供相关的代码示例与部署建议。

1、Vue.js的CDN地址

Vue.js 为开发者提供了方便的 CDN 地址,可以直接在 HTML 文件中通过 script 标签引入,使用官方 CDN 的好处是可以确保获取到最新版本的库文件,但需注意网络问题可能带来的影响,官方 Vue.js 的 CDN 地址可以在 Vue.js 官方网站或相关社区文章中找到。

2、环境判断与CDN使用策略

对于不同的开发阶段和环境,可以选择不同的 Vue.js 引入方式,在开发环境中,开发者可能更倾向于使用 npm 安装 Vue.js 以便获得源码调试的便利,而在生产环境中,利用 CDN 的优势可以提升用户访问速度,根据环境变量来动态选择引用方式是一种常见的实践。

3、CDN引入的实践

在HTML文件中,通过添加script标签引入Vue.js的CDN地址,即可在浏览器中快速加载和使用Vue.js,需要注意的是,应确保CDN链接的稳定性和可靠性,防止因链接失效导致的问题。

4、CDN加速优化

除了直接引用外,还可以结合CDN服务提供商的加速优化功能,例如通过配置缓存规则、压缩资源文件等方式进一步优化性能。

5、兼容性与更新

使用CDN时,应关注Vue.js的兼容性信息,确保所选版本与目标浏览器兼容,要定期检查CDN地址是否有更新,以便及时升级到包含最新功能和修复的版本。

CDN作为一种高效的资源分发手段,在引入Vue.js时具有显著优势,但也需要谨慎处理其中的潜在风险,开发者应根据实际项目需求和环境条件,采取合理的CDN使用策略,并注意维护和更新,以确保应用性能的最优化。

0